17.04.202606:12:25UTC+00Wheat Rallies on Weather, Fertilizer Concerns

Wheat futures hovered near $6 per bushel, close to a fourteen-month high and poised for a weekly gain of about 5%—the strongest advance in nearly two months—as ongoing weather threats and fertilizer shortages linked to the Iran conflict heightened supply concerns. Drought conditions are expected to persist across the US Great Plains, particularly in hard red winter wheat areas, while dryness in parts of the Black Sea region and Europe continues to pressure yield prospects. In Australia, constrained access to farm inputs and continued dry weather are projected to push planted area to multi-year lows, raising alarms for one of the world’s key exporters. Fertilizer supply disruptions stemming from tensions involving the US and Iran are adding further support to prices, especially with the Strait of Hormuz still largely closed. Although ample global inventories may cap further gains, production risks in Australia and Argentina could provide additional upside. Meanwhile, US wheat export sales totaled 231,300 metric tons for the week ended April 9, in line with expectations.
